If you're going 3.73 why not 4.10? That would be a huge improvement. X pipe is great for sound and probably will gain the most out of it if you change up the whole exhaust. New gears won't give you more power but it will definitely lower your times and improve your acceleration more than an x pipe would. Just my $0.02.
